Irradiation of either pyrazine-2,6-d2 ( 1-2,6-d2) or pyrazine-2,3-d2 (1-2,3-d2) in the vapor phase at 254 nm resulted in the formation of pyrimidine-2,4-d2 ( 2-2,4-d2) and pyrimidine-4,5-d2 ( 2-4,5-d2). Irradaiton of pyrazine-2,5-d2 ( 1-2,5-d2) in the vapor phase led, however, to pyrimidine-4,6-d2 (2-4,6-d2) and pyrimidine-2,5-d2 (2-2,5-d2). These results are consistent with a mechanism involving 2,6-bonding, nitrogen migration, and rearomatization.
